The Happy Tarot Deck Review

The Happy Tarot is a cheerful and upbeat deck set in a colorful land of candy that works brilliantly with the title.

This tarot seems far from absurd; it is based on the Rider Waite Smith pattern, and all of the decks feature scenarios that are easily recognizable from their historical forerunners.

The realm of the Happy Tarot is gentle and lovely, with a lot of thoroughness. The landscape where the people live is a delectable combination of kid’s candies and favorite treats.

Candy floss trees and blossoms formed from boiled desserts blooming in gardens and countryside sceneries, and a cascade of sparkles, candies, popsicles, and confectionery and icy delights fall on the surface.

Heights in The Moonlight, Mortality, and the Leaning Structure resemble huge bars of chocolates, while mansions and palaces are invariably made of ginger.

Deck Specifications in Detail:

  • Name: Happy Tarot
  • Author: Serena Ficca
  • Distributor: Lo Scarabeo 2015
  • Kind of Deck: Tarot Deck
  • Total Cards: 78
  • Minor Arcana: 22
  • Major Arcana: 56
  • Card Language: None
  • Design on the back: Purple and mauve moon, stars, clouds, owls, and lollipops.
  • Supplementary Reading: Multilingual pamphlet with 64 pages.
  • Card Measurement: 2 5/8″ x 4 3/4″

Pros: Cons:
  • The graphics are charming and adorable, and the RWS impact can be seen all across the set. This makes it straightforward to read quickly.
  • The cards have no borders and only a bottom with the card number and sign for the secondary decks, allowing the visuals to be seen to their full potential.
  • While there may be similar ‘cute’ cards on the sale, this will undoubtedly fulfill the demand of sweets addicts.
  • The cards are in full size, and despite being dense with information, these are quite simple to read.
  • The card’s stock is thinner but enough for a commercially viable deck, and the reversible backline makes them easy to shift.
  • For those who do not like a cheerful and simple theme, this Tarot is not for them.
  • The box might be difficult to open as it is a tuck box.
  • The illustration of the cards may cause confusion and complication.
  • There is a lack of variety in the photographs.
